Understanding audience and intent

Effective campaigns start with a clear view of who you are trying to reach and what they care about. Identifying audience segments, their common pain points and preferred media helps tailor messages that resonate. This paid article means aligning headlines, visuals and calls-to-action with real needs, rather than generic selling points. The result is higher engagement, stronger click-through rates and more meaningful interactions across devices and platforms.

Paid article as a content tactic

Incorporating a paid article into a broader content plan can offer depth while maintaining editorial integrity. A paid article should read as informative and useful, not simply promotional copy. It’s important to disclose sponsorship clearly and ensure the piece adds value through expert insight, practical tips or case studies. When executed with quality journalism in mind, a paid article can extend reach, foster trust and drive qualified traffic to owned assets.

Measuring impact and optimisation

Measurement turns investment into insight. Tracking key indicators such as reach, engagement, conversion rate and revenue per visitor helps illuminate what works and what doesn’t. A structured testing framework—varying headlines, visuals and placement—permits rapid learning. Regular reviews keep campaigns aligned with evolving business goals and shifts in audience behaviour, while avoiding wasteful spend.

Practical planning for budgets

Budgeting for online advertising requires a balance between ambition and discipline. Start with a clear allocation plan, reserving funds for experimentation, creative refreshes and optimisation. Consider seasonality, competitive pressure and channel mix to optimise ROI. A pragmatic approach keeps teams focused on measurable outcomes and ensures that resources are available for sustained improvement over time.
